> On 26.09.23 13:33, Peter Maydell wrote:
> > On Mon, 25 Sept 2023 at 20:41, Vladimir Sementsov-Ogievskiy
> > <vsementsov@yandex-team.ru> wrote:
> >>
> >> This @size parameter often comes from fd. We'd better check it before
> >> doing read and allocation.
> >>
> >> Chose 1G as high enough empiric bound.
> >
> > Empirical for who?
> >

> > This doesn't really help anything:
> > (1) if the value is really big, it doesn't cause any terrible
> > consequences -- QEMU will just exit because the allocation
> > fails, which is fine because this will be at QEMU startup
> > and only happens if the user running QEMU gives us a silly file
> > (2) we do a lot of other "allocate and abort on failure"
> > elsewhere in the ELF loader, for instance the allocations of
> > the symbol table and relocs in the load_symbols and
> > elf_reloc functions, and then on a bigger scale when we
> > work with the actual data in the ELF file
>
> Reasonable..
>
> Don't you have an idea, how to somehow mark the value "trusted" for Coverity?
In the web UI, I just mark it "false positive" in the dropdown, and
move on. Coverity has an absolute ton of false positives, and you
really can't work with it unless you have a workflow for ignoring them.
